文档介绍:前端自学总结标准以及W3C标准是什么? 标签闭合、标签小写、不乱嵌套、使用外链css和js、结构行为表现的分离。和html有什么区别 XHTML元素必须被正确地嵌套,闭合,区分大小写,文档必须拥有根元素。 ?块级元素有哪些? 行内元素:abimgembrispaninputselectstrongtextarea 块级元素:divph1-h6formuldloltable ? 行内元素不可以设置宽高,不独占一行; 块级元素可以设置宽高,独占一行。 ,加margin-top和padding-top可以吗?margin-top,padding-top无效的盒模型由什么组成? 内容,border,margin,padding ?可以做什么? display:block行内元素转换为块级元素 display:inline块级元素转换为行内元素 display:inline-block转为内联元素选择符有哪些? 选择器 ? 可继承:font-sizefont-familycolor,ullidldddt; 不可继承:borderpaddingmarginwidthheight; 优先级算法如何计算? !important>id>class>标签!important比内联优先级高*优先级就近原则,样式定义最近者为准; *以最后载入的样式为准; :center和line-height有什么区别? text-align是水平对齐,line-height是行间。 ,分别是什么?作用是什么? 结构层Html表示层CSS行为层js ? Alt是图片属性,让搜索引擎认识你的图片。当图片不显示的时候显示。 title是网站标题,是seo中最重要的属性。(seo:做关键词给百度搜索用的) ? Css精灵把一堆小的图片整合到一张大的图片上,减轻HTTP的请求数量。 ? 标签使用的合理性,对于搜索引擎的抓取有好处。标签和strong标签,i标签和em标签的区别? 后者有语义,前者则无。与h1的区别。 title侧重于网站信息标题从文章而言,h1侧重于文章主题站在seo的角度看,好网站少不了title,好文章少不了h1标题,title权重高于h1。 ,各自的优缺点 :both :auto (用于非IE浏览器) :none和visibility:hidden的区别是什么? visibility:hidden----将元素隐藏,但是还占着位置。 display:none----将元素的显示设为无,不占任何的位置。 :使用display:inline,取消元素的块级属性。像素问题使用float引起的解决:使用dislpay:inline;margin:-3px :使用正确的书写顺序linkvisitedhoveractive z-index问题解决:给父级添加position:relative 透明解决:使用js代码最小高度!Important解决出现边框 ? 状态码都有那些。 200OK//客户端请求成功 400BadRequest//客户端请求有语法错误,不能被服务器所理解 403Forbidden//服务器收到请求,但是拒绝提供服务 404NotFound//请求资源不存在,输入了错误的URL 500InternalServerError//服务器发生不可预期的错误 503ServerUnavailable//服务器当前不能处理客户端的请求,一段时间后可能恢复正常 ? ,js文件数量及大小(减少重复性代码,代码重复利用),压缩CSS和Js代码 ,把js放置页面底部 属性absolute与relative的区别? absolute绝对定位//相对于浏览器定位 relative相对定位//相对于前面的容器定位的有那些新标签? 新增伪类有那些? p:fi